Blue Ridge Community College Earns Place on National Honor Roll for Community Service
One of 690 institutions of higher education to receive this honor
Blue Ridge Community College was named to the 2013 President’s Higher Education Community Service Honor Roll. This designation is the highest honor a college or university can receive for its commitment to volunteering, service learning, and civic engagement. Continue reading

Legislative Visits
Pulling into the BRCC parking lot at 6:30 in the morning isn’t a common occurrence for most students. However, twice so far this year groups of Blue Ridge students, accompanied by staff and board members, did just that. They started their day bright and early to make the trip to Richmond to visit with local legislators, sharing their stories about the importance of the College and asking them to advocate for legislation favoring the community college system, and higher education in general.
